But we all share one goal: to improve the world responsibly and safely. KBR is seeking Quality Engineers to support NASA programs. We are looking for both full time & part time. These Quality Engineers will support the development and implementation of mission assurance requirements over the entire project life cycle. These Quality Engineers will also focus on supplier surveillance and inspections. This position will monitor processes for compliance to the developer's procedures and contractual requirements. Processes to be reviewed prior to use and monitored when used may include:
- Printed Circuit Board quality assessment
- Workmanship including coatings
- Soldering
- ESD controls
- Clean room activities and controls
- Cable and harness fabrication
- Contamination control
- Parts and materials control
- Control of drawings and procedures
- Equipment moves (e.g. slings, cranes, and hydro sets)
- Hazardous operations
- Contractor responses to corrective action requests
- Build records
- Delivery, storage and transport of flight and non-flight hardware, and critical ground support equipment (GSE)
- Ensure that flight hardware anomalies, corrective actions, and re-verifications are documented in accordance with the contractors' non-conformance and corrective action system
- Participate in production planning, review manufacturing flow plans and participate in Manufacturing and Test Readiness Reviews (MRRs and TRRs)
- Examine process design and/or process qualification records, procedure review, work order review, and verifying that labs carry required certifications
- Review flight hardware records and ensure all open items are identified and addressed prior to the performance of tests
- Monitor contractor quality and safety controls, and participate in quality assurance activities during fabrication, integration, and tests
- QAR monitoring
- Support activities related to root cause corrective actions
- Support processes for collecting and analyzing data that measures supplier success
- Review the supplier's CDRL documents related to quality assurance and provide recommendations
- Review flight hardware records for completeness prior to integration & final acceptance testing
- Perform a final instrument "buy-off" review
- Complete thorough inspections

- GMIPS for Electronic Boards
- Pre-cap inspection of hybrid microcircuits
- 100% of solder joints prior to conformal coating of each flight printed wiring assembly prior to conformal coating.
- 100% of conformal coatings on flight printed wiring assemblies.
- Final workmanship inspection prior to box level final closure prior to integration into the next level of assembly.
- Connector mates to mission hardware integrated into the spacecraft.
- General workmanship quality prior to final acceptance testing
- General workmanship prior to shipment
- Confirm shipping packaging conforms to requirements and is adequate
- IPC J-STD-001xS (Soldering, Space Addendum)
- NASA-STD-8739.1 (Staking and Conformal Coating)
- NASA-STD-8739.4 or IPC/WHMA-A-620xS (Crimping, Cables & Wiring)
- Developer-specific ESD Control training or training traceable to ANSI/ESD S20.20 (Electrostatic Discharge)
- NASA-STD-8739.6 (Workmanship Implementation Standard)1
- Pre-cap inspection methods derived from MIL-STD-883
